I make my own soups so I can control the ingredients and more importantly the sodium you tend to get in prepared soups. Early on I made a taco soup that I used ground turkey for the base and pureed the life out of it. I couldn`t have it until week 4 on my diet though.

Now I often use low fat plain greek yogurt to add protein to my soups. It makes them creamy without adding milk or cream. 3\4 of a cup has 18 grams of protein. Plus..it tastes great in squash soup! :-)
